What is an IPTV Reseller?

An IPTV reseller is someone who purchases bulk IPTV subscriptions from a main provider and resells them to end-users for a profit. Resellers operate with the help of a dedicated reseller panel provided by the IPTV service provider. This panel allows them to create, manage, and monitor user accounts efficiently.

The beauty of IPTV reselling lies in its low startup cost and scalability. You don't need expensive infrastructure or deep technical knowledge to begin. Instead, your success depends on marketing, customer support, and choosing a reliable IPTV provider with robust servers and excellent streaming quality.

The Role of IPTV Servers

At the heart of any IPTV operation lies the IPTV server infrastructure. These servers are responsible for storing, encoding, and delivering content to viewers via the internet. The performance of your IPTV service depends heavily on the stability and capacity of these servers.

Key components of an IPTV server setup include:

  • Content Delivery Servers: These ensure that the video content reaches users without buffering or downtime.

  • Middleware: Acts as the control center, managing user interfaces, channels, and billing.

  • EPG (Electronic Program Guide): Offers users a TV-guide-style navigation experience.

  • Load Balancers: Distribute traffic evenly across servers to avoid overload.

As a reseller, it’s essential to partner with a provider that offers a powerful server infrastructure, guaranteeing uptime, minimal latency, and high-definition (HD) or 4K streaming quality.

Challenges to Be Aware Of

While IPTV reselling is promising, it’s not without its hurdles:

  • Legal Risks: Make sure your IPTV provider operates legally. Selling pirated content could expose you to legal actions.

  • Technical Downtime: If your provider’s servers go down, it reflects poorly on you. That’s why partnering with a reputable IPTV provider is essential.

  • Competition: The IPTV market is competitive. To stand out, focus on delivering better service, customer support, and unique content bundles.
